Font Pairing and Practical Tips
To keep things balanced, I paired Billing Lottre with a clean sans serif font for body text. This combination worked wonders for my blog posts and product descriptions. The serif font took center stage for headlines, while the sans serif kept the rest of the content easy to read.
If you're looking for something more decorative, you could pair it with a script or handwritten font for accents. Just be careful not to overdo it—less is often more when it comes to typography.
Before finalizing any designs, I always check the font’s file formats, multilingual support, and licensing options. For commercial use, it's important to ensure that Billing Lottre is available under a license that covers all the materials you plan to use it for, whether it's print, digital, or merchandise.
